#1e70ed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#1e70ed is composed of 11.8% red, 43.9% green and 92.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 87.3% cyan, 52.7% magenta, 0% yellow and 7.1% black. It has a hue angle of 216.2 degrees, a saturation of 85.2% and a lightness of 52.4%. #1e70ed color hex could be obtained by blending #3ce0ff with #0000db. Closest websafe color is: #3366ff.

Shades and Tints of #1e70ed
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#01050b is the darkest color, while #f8fbfe is the lightest one.

Tones of #1e70ed
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#858586 is the less saturated color, while #156ef6 is the most saturated one.
